    摘要: The invention relates to a slide projector with automatic slide changer and stationary slide magazines (10,11) on each side of the optical pathway of the projector, the respective slide magazine (10,11) provided in the shortside with a feed and discharge opening for slide frames (8) which is located in the focal plane of the slide projector. Between the slide magazines (10,11) a slide frame transport device is located, which consists of two toothed belts (2,3) provided with external dog members (7) for transporting the slide frames (8) from one slide magazine (10) to the other (11), and vice versa. In the projection position of the slide projector support members (12,13 and, respectively, 16,17) facing to the toothed belts (2,3) are provided for the slide frames (8). Levers (20,21) are provided behind the toothed belts (2,3) directly in front of the respective slide magazine (10,11) for inserting the slide frames (8).

    摘要: A microfilm reader with a projection system through which individual images on a piece of microfiche can be projected through a viewing screen. The reader has a base structure on which is mounted a carriage assembly which holds the microfilm and is mounted for horizontal movement relative to the base structure. A series of magnets mounted on the carriage assembly and base structure causes the carriage assembly to be magnetically held in predetermined positions. In one embodiment the predetermined magnetically held positions are identical to the distances between the individual images on the microfiche whereby images from the microfiche can be precisely positioned on the screen without the operator viewing the image on the screen.

    摘要: A reading device for viewing microfilms, transparencies, fiches, and the like, comprising a plate-shaped projection screen made of transparent material supported on a frame structure with the projection screen disposed in a slanted position relative to the horizontal. The screen has on the viewing side a frosted surface and on the opposite side prism-shaped parts. A source of light is disposed into the frame structure beneath a carrier for placing an article to be projected thereon. A mirror assembly is disposed in the frame structure to reflect light rays passed from the light source through the article to the prism-shaped parts and through the projection screen. The prism-shaped parts are disposed in lengthwise rows and have prism surfaces extending at an angle with respect to the opposite side of the projection screen for deflecting the light rays reflected from the mirror assembly so as to project an image of the article within an angle converging toward a viewer situated above and in front of the screen. The prism surfaces progressively increase from the lower end of the screen through the upper end of the screen to provide substantially uniform illumination.

    摘要: A film supporting and positioning system includes a film holding or gripping head for engaging an edge portion of the film and supporting the same in a cantilever fashion. The gripping head may include a frictional contact gripping arrangement or a vacuum head by which the film is held along one edge thereof. The gripping head is displaceable in a plurality of orthogonal directions so that the film may be inserted into and oriented relative to the image plane of an optical recording/reproducing system. In the vicinity of this image plane, a film support bearing is provided, in order that a prescribed region of the film, in which information may be recorded may be properly irradiated by a light beam. Preferably, the film support bearing is provided by a fluid bearing platen which is thermodynamically non-throttling.

    摘要: An electronically controlled photographic image utilization device is arranged to transport a roll of microfilm having all images printed thereon in separate photographic areas, each area being arranged in a microfiche-type format. The photographic image utilization device has an automatic call-up feature so that any given photographic area may be selected in a first dimension and projected responsive to the push of a button, the operation of a rotary switch or both. A special bar code is printed along the edge of the film and used in conjunction with a closed loop film control system to eliminate the need for precise, clock-controlled synchronization between the film transport and the code reading. Preferably, the bar code is read by optical electronic sensors. Responsive thereto, the electronic control system accurately positions a selected photographic image, on the microfilm, within a viewing area. Thereafter, and while the film transport is being held stationary, any image on the microfilm may be selected for projection by a manual movement in second and third dimensions of a simple lens positioning mechanism which is small, compact, and easily moved. The reader may also be operated manually so that the automatic controls may be bypassed, if desired.

    摘要: A microfiche reader according to the present invention includes a housing consisting of a hood portion and a base portion, a screen located within the hood portion and visible through the front end of the hood, a combined microfiche carriage and index holder, a lens assembly and a projection system. The combined microfiche carriage and index holder serves to accurately locate the microfiche with respect to the index grid. By reason of the fact that there is no relative movement between the index grid and the microfiche in use, it is always possible to accurately locate the microfiche with respect to the projection system by reference to the index grid. The index grid is illuminated by an index illuminating lens carried by the housing. The illuminating lens is located in a fixed relationship with respect to the projection path which again contributes to the facility with which the microfiche may be accurately located in the projection path. The lens assembly includes a support plate mounted above the microfiche carriage and a slide member mounted in the support plate and a pair of lens members mounted in the slide members so that either one may be located in the projection path as required. The projection system includes a demountable modular unit which may be easily mounted in and removed from the housing. A prefocussed lamp is mounted on the modular unit and the position of the prefocussed lamp with respect to the modular unit may be adjusted so as to vary the length of the illuminating path between the prefocussed lamp and the condenser means whereby the optical system may be adjusted to accommodate objective lenses having different characteristics. The projection system consists of a prefocussed lamp which projects a beam of light onto a cold mirror which reflects the beam of light through an optical condenser which in turn directs the beam of light through the microfiche to an objective lens mounted thereabove. A first surface mirror is mounted in the housing and reflects the beam of light emitted from the objective lens to a viewing screen mounted in the housing. The viewing screen consists of a unitary body of molded plastics material having an image receiving surface formed with a concave spherical curvature. The image receiving surface may be plated with a suitable coating to form an image reflecting coating thereon.

    摘要: A cover plate for a microform reader. The reader includes a carrier for holding a microform, with the cover plate being pivotally mounted on the carrier for movement between open and closed positions. A spring interconnects the cover plate and the carrier and coacts with an inclined surface in the reader to progressively add energy to the spring as the carrier is moved to a first position from a second position to enable the spring to automatically lift the cover plate as the carrier is moved towards the first position to permit the removal and insertion of a microform in the carrier.

    摘要: A slide projector for use with magazines of the flexible type in which slides are supported for movement around a closed-loop path and are swingable one by one into and out of a slide-projection station about an axis defined by a rotary drive shaft. The magazine has individual clip-type slide-holding elements that slide along an endless path and have frames in which slides are held. A condensing lens is mounted and guided for movement from a normal operating position close to the slide-projection station and in the path of the slides, to a retracted position out of the path, with a combined reciprocating and swinging motion, and is moved back and forth by a rotary crank mechanism that is driven by the slide-feeding mechanism, to shift the lens rapidly out of and back into the operating position during each slide change, with a dwell in the retracted position for the change.
